Frequently Asked Questions

Is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h safe?

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h has a CrimeRadar safety score of 49/100, rated Average. A total of 459 crimes were recorded in the last 12 months, a decrease of 25.7% year-on-year — a positive trend for the area. Crime levels in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h are broadly in line with the UK average.

How many crimes were recorded in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h in the last 12 months?

459 crimes were recorded in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h in the last 12 months, spanning all reported crime categories from violent crime to vehicle crime and anti-social behaviour. This represents a decrease of 25.7% compared to the previous 12-month period (618 crimes). The most common category was Violent Crime, with 185 incidents.

What is the most common crime in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h?

The most common crime in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h is Violent Crime, with 185 incidents recorded in the last 12 months — accounting for 40.3% of all reported crimes in the area. You can view a full breakdown of all crime categories, including anti-social behaviour, vehicle crime, and burglary, in the Crime by Category section on this page.

Is crime in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h increasing or decreasing?

Crime in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h is decreasing. The year-on-year trend shows a fall of 25.7% — from 618 crimes in the previous 12 months to 459 in the most recent period. This downward trend is a positive sign for residents and prospective homebuyers.

What is the crime resolution rate in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h?

23.1% of crimes recorded in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h resulted in a formal outcome in the last 12 months. Formal outcomes include charges brought, cautions issued, fixed penalty notices, or other official resolutions recorded by Lincolnshire Police. The national average outcome rate in England and Wales is typically 5–15% across most crime types. A higher rate suggests more effective local enforcement.

How much violent crime is there in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h?

185 violent crimes were recorded in Wainfleet and Burgh Le Marsh in the last 12 months — representing 40.3% of all reported crimes. Anti-social behaviour accounted for a further 105 incidents. Violent crime encompasses assault, robbery, and related offences as classified by the UK Home Office. Data is sourced from official police reports submitted to data.police.uk.
